Background/Objectives: Chemotherapy-induced peripheral neuropathy (CIPN) is a common, dose-limiting complication of cancer therapy and a major contributor to chronic neuropathic pain among cancer survivors. Although traditionally managed as a treatment-related toxicity, persistent CIPN frequently persists long after chemotherapy completion and is increasingly recognized as a major survivorship and palliative care challenge. This review synthesizes current mechanistic, clinical, and translational evidence and reframes persistent CIPN as a chronic neuropathic cancer pain syndrome. Methods: A narrative review of peer-reviewed literature was conducted using PubMed/MEDLINE, Embase, and the Cochrane Library, supplemented by manual review of key references and clinical guidelines. Background: Treatment options are limited, and outcomes remain poor for patients with metastatic uveal melanoma (MUM). We conducted an investigator-initiated, prospective, single-arm, single-institution, phase II study evaluating the combination of an FAK inhibitor (defactinib) with a RAF/MEK inhibitor (avutometinib) for the treatment of MUM. Methods: From February 2021 through January 2023, 12 patients with MUM were treated with the combination of defactinib and avutometinib. Meningiomas are the most common primary central nervous system tumors, and while most are benign, atypical and anaplastic variants frequently recur and have limited effective treatment options. Recent trials of PD-1 blockade in unselected meningioma cohorts have demonstrated modest activity, with low objective response rates. These findings highlight the need to identify molecular biomarkers that may predict immunotherapy sensitivity in this disease. Anthocyanins are naturally occurring flavonoid pigments widely distributed in plants and are recognized for their antioxidant and anti-inflammatory activities. However, the molecular mechanisms underlying their potential immunomodulatory effects remain poorly characterized, particularly regarding their direct interactions with key signaling cytokines. In this study, a set of selected anthocyanins was investigated using a hierarchical computational workflow targeting three major pro-inflammatory cytokines: interleukin-2 (IL-2), interleukin-17 (IL-17), and tumor necrosis factor-α (TNF-α). Molecular docking analyses identified primulin and antirrhinin as the most favorable binders, forming stabilizing hydrogen bonds and hydrophobic interactions within predicted cytokine interaction interfaces. Human immunodeficiency virus type 1 (HIV-1) is a retrovirus that integrates into the host cell's DNA as a provirus. Transcription from the provirus is regulated in large part by cellular proteins and epigenetic factors. These may be repressive or permissive to productive infection. The host factors that regulate this balance are therefore attractive targets for HIV-1 therapeutics. Indeed, proviral chromatin is the focus of two of the current HIV-1 cure strategies. PURPOSE: To discuss the recent evidence that Janus kinase (JAK) inhibitors can cause viral retinitis.

METHODS: A commentary on the case report in this issue and a review of cases in the literature.

RESULTS: A total of 6 cases have now been reported of cytomegalovirus retinitis associated with Jak inhibitors. Additionally, there was a case of bilateral toxoplasma retinitis and a case of herpetic scleritis.

Dengue virus (DENV) is a mosquito-transmitted flavivirus that circulates globally as four distinct serotypes and poses a substantial threat to public health. There are an estimated ~96 million symptomatic infections yearly, including severe cases of dengue fever, underscoring the urgency of identifying effective therapeutics targeting all four serotypes. Nucleoside analogs, which mimic endogenous nucleosides to inhibit viral RNA replication, offer a promising strategy for broad-spectrum antiviral development. Here, we conducted a high-throughput screen of 1,101 nucleoside analogs against DENV serotype 2 (DENV2) in a panel of human cell models, including human epithelial cells, hepatocytes, and fibroblasts. PURPOSE: Low-grade serous ovarian carcinoma (LGSOC) is a distinct form of ovarian cancer characterized by younger patient age and relative chemoresistance. The GOG281/LOGS trial (NCT02101788) investigated the efficacy of the MEK inhibitor trametinib compared with physician's choice standard-of-care (SOC) in patients with LGSOC with persistent/recurrent disease. The study demonstrated significantly improved progression-free survival (PFS) in the trametinib-treated arm.

EXPERIMENTAL DESIGN: Two hundred and sixty patients with recurrent/persistent LGSOC were enrolled and randomly assigned in GOG281. A novel subtype of microglia, lipid droplet accumulation microglia (LDAMs), has been identified in the aged brain, which is characterized by sustained inflammation and senescent-like phenotypes. LDAMs are deeply involved in promoting brain aging as well as the pathogenesis of multiple neurodegenerative diseases. Cocaine can alter brain lipidomic profiles, induce microglial activation, and accelerate brain aging. This suggests that cocaine might affect microglial lipid metabolism, which ultimately aggravates aging-related neurological disorders in people with addictions. Objectives

Explore the efficacy of tramadol for neurogenic cough and describe the longitudinal treatment experience.

Methods

A retrospective case series of adults with chronic cough who were treated with tramadol for neurogenic cough. A complete response was defined as no pathologic coughing, and a partial response was defined as 50% or greater reduction in severity or frequency.

Results

Hydralazine (HYZ), a treatment for preeclampsia and hypertensive crisis, is listed by the World Health Organization as an essential medicine. Its mode of action has remained unknown through its seven decades of clinical use. Here, we identify 2-aminoethanethiol dioxygenase (ADO), a key mediator of targeted protein degradation, as a selective HYZ target. The drug chelates ADO's metallocofactor and can alkylate one of its ligands. The BCL2 family of proteins plays a pivotal role in regulating apoptosis and cellular homeostasis, making them critical therapeutic targets in cancer and other diseases characterized by pathological cell survival. BH3 mimetics, small molecules that selectively inhibit anti-apoptotic BCL2 family members, have achieved significant clinical success, particularly in hematologic malignancies. However, several challenges remain, including resistance mechanisms, toxicity (such as MCL1 inhibitor-associated cardiotoxicity), and the intricate balance between apoptotic and non-apoptotic functions. Synthetic cathinones are the second most common class of substances belonging to the category of new psychoactive substances (NPS). N-ethylpentedrone (NEPD) self-administration was reported, making it important to elucidate its metabolic pathway to improve its detection. NEPD is often taken together with other substances; confidently identifying its intake is important for accurate toxicological analysis and understanding its toxicity. NEPD metabolism was studied following incubation with human hepatocytes and analysis by liquid chromatography-high-resolution mass spectrometry paired with Compound Discoverer software (Thermo Fisher Scientific). BACKGROUND: Recessive dystrophic epidermolysis bullosa (RDEB) is an epithelial fragility disease primarily affecting the skin and is caused by variants in the COL7A1 gene. Individuals with RDEB are predisposed to develop highly aggressive cutaneous squamous cell carcinomas (SCCs) which are the most common cause of premature death. There is a lack of effective prevention or treatment options for patients with RDEB-SCC.

Nasopharyngeal carcinoma (NPC) is a cancer arising from the epithelial cells of the nasopharynx, which is rare in Western countries but extremely prevalent in Borneo and the Southern China region. Present-day hurdles in NPC treatment that lead to poor quality of life and poor survival include distant metastasis and resistance to chemoradiotherapy. Silvestrol and its 5'''-epimer, episilvestrol, are compounds isolated from the plant Aglaia stellatopilosa, which is endemic to Borneo. Silvestrol, a protein synthesis inhibitor, preferentially inhibits the translation of cancer-associated mRNAs. CX-5461 is an inhibitor of RNA polymerase I that catalyzes rRNA synthesis.
